#3f618c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f618c is composed of 24.7% red, 38%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 213.5 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 39.8%. #3f618c color hex could be obtained by blending #7ec2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3f618c color description : Dark moderate blue.
#3f618c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f618c has RGB values of R:63, G:97,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4153740.

Shades and Tints of #3f618c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020305 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f618c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e656d is the less saturated color, while #015aca is the most saturated one.
